Outgoing Calls

The last 90 outgoing calls are stored in the Outgoing calls log.
Review the Outgoing calls log for the time and date of a call, as
well as other information.

1.

In standby mode, press

or

, then select Calls

Outgoing Calls. A list of your outgoing calls appears in the

display.

2.

Highlight a call. You have the following options:

To compose and send a message to the caller, press the Msg soft

key. The Send Message screen appears in the display. (For more
information, refer to “Create and Send Text Messages” on
page 53 or
“Send Picture Messages in Standby Mode” on
page 56.)

To view further information about the call, press OPEN (

or

).

To access further options, press the Options soft key. The following

options appear in the display:

Save — Save the number to your Contacts.

Details — Contacts calls only — Lets you view the Contacts entry for
the recipient of this call.

Erase — Erase the selected call from your Outgoing calls list.

Lock/Unlock — Blocks/permits erasure of the selected call from your
Outgoing call list.

Erase all — Erase all unlocked calls from your Outgoing call list.

View TimerCall Timer screen appears in the display listing the
number and types of calls and their total durations. (See “Call Timer”
on page 29 for mor
e information.)

Select an option to perform its function.

Incoming Calls

The last 90 Incoming calls are stored in your phone’s Incoming
calls log. You can review the Incoming calls log for time and date
of each call, as well as other information.

1.

In standby mode, press

or

, then select Calls

Incoming Calls. A list of your Incoming calls appears in

the display.

2.

Highlight a call. You have the following options:

To compose and send a message to the caller, press the Msg soft

key. The Send Message screen appears in the display. (For more
information, refer to “Create and Send Text Messages” on
page 53 or
“Send Picture Messages in Standby Mode” on
page 56.)

To view further information about the call, press OPEN (

or

).

To access further options, press the Options soft key. The following

options appear in the display:

Save — Save the number to your Contacts.

Details — Contacts calls only — Lets you view the Contacts entry for
the originator of this call.
